Product details
Overview
SN74LVC1G240 from Texas Instruments is a single-channel inverting buffer/driver with 3-state output, designed for signal conditioning and bus isolation in space-constrained digital systems. It operates from 1.65V to 5.5V, delivers ±24mA drive at 3.3V, achieves 3.7ns max propagation delay, and supports 5.5V-tolerant inputs - enabling level translation in mixed-voltage interfaces such as microcontroller GPIO expansion or sensor interface staging.
For engineers reviewing the SN74LVC1G240 datasheet, SN74LVC1G240 pinout, SN74LVC1G240 application, or SN74LVC1G240 equivalent, key selection criteria include its DSBGA-5 (YZP) ultra-miniature footprint, Ioff-enabled live insertion capability, low 10μA ICC quiescent current, and precise 3-state timing parameters (ten/tdis) critical for synchronous bus control and reset hold functions.
Technical Context
The SN74LVC1G240 implements a CMOS-based inverting logic gate with active-low output-enable control, where OE = LOW enables inverted A→Y transmission and OE = HIGH forces high-impedance output. Its balanced push-pull output stage provides symmetrical sourcing/sinking capability up to ±24mA at 3.3V, supporting clean signal integrity into light capacitive loads (≤50pF).
It features over-voltage tolerant inputs (up to 5.5V independent of VCC), partial-power-down protection (Ioff ≤ ±10μA when VCC = 0V), and input transition rate compliance (5 ns/V at 5V) - making it suitable for hot-swap interfaces, controller reset sequencing, and voltage-level bridging between 1.8V/3.3V/5V domains without external level shifters.

Pinout & Package
SN74LVC1G240 YZP package is a 5-pin DSBGA (Die Size Ball Grid Array) measuring 1.39mm × 0.89mm, optimized for ultra-dense PCB layouts and automated assembly. It uses solder-ball terminations compatible with standard reflow profiles and offers superior thermal resistance (RθJA = 132°C/W) versus SOT-23 or SC70 alternatives.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1 (OE) | Active-low output enable | Drives Y into high-Z when HIGH; requires pull-up to VCC for power-up safety - minimum resistor value determined by driver sink capability |
| 2 (A) | Inverting data input | CMOS-compatible input accepting 0–5.5V; must not float - tie unused A to VCC or GND via 10kΩ resistor |
| 3 (GND) | Ground reference | Primary return path for all output currents and supply leakage; requires low-inductance connection to system ground plane |
| 4 (Y) | Inverting 3-state output | Delivers inverted A signal when OE = LOW; enters high-impedance state when OE = HIGH - no internal pull-up/down |
| 5 (VCC) | Positive supply | Power rail for logic and output stages; requires local 0.1μF ceramic bypass capacitor placed adjacent to pin |

Equivalent & Alternatives
The following parts are listed as comparable options for similar inverting buffer with 3-state output applications.
| Alternative Part | Technical Difference | Application Difference | Selection Advice |
|---|---|---|---|
| SN74LVC1G04YZPR | No 3-state output; fixed inverter only - lacks OE control and high-Z mode | Cannot perform bus isolation or dynamic signal gating; limited to static inversion roles | Select only if 3-state functionality is unnecessary and board layout allows removal of OE trace |
| NC7SZ240M5X | Same function but SC70-5 package (2.0mm × 2.1mm); 4.5ns max tpd at 3.3V; Ioff = ±1μA | Larger footprint and slightly slower switching - less optimal for ultra-dense or highest-speed timing-critical paths | Choose when SC70 compatibility is required or when lower Ioff is prioritized over size/speed |
Compared with SN74LVC1G240, SN74LVC1G04YZPR omits critical 3-state control needed for bus arbitration, while NC7SZ240M5X trades 0.8mm² area and 0.8ns speed for marginally better Ioff - making SN74LVC1G240 the optimal balance of miniaturization, timing performance, and functional completeness for modern embedded designs.

FAQ
What is the recommended pull-up resistor value for OE on SN74LVC1G240?
The OE pin must be pulled up to VCC to ensure high-impedance output during power-up. The minimum resistor value depends on the current-sinking capability of the driving circuit - typically 10kΩ suffices for most microcontroller GPIOs. For stronger drivers, values down to 1kΩ may be used, provided the resulting current stays within the OE pin's absolute maximum rating (±20mA). Always verify against the specific controller's sink specification.
Can SN74LVC1G240 drive a 5V-tolerant input while operating at 1.8V VCC?
Yes. SN74LVC1G240 accepts input voltages up to 5.5V regardless of VCC level, including when VCC = 1.8V. This over-voltage tolerance allows it to interface directly with 5V sensors or legacy peripherals without external level-shifting components - a key advantage confirmed in Section 5.3 (Recommended Operating Conditions) and Section 7.3.5 of the datasheet.
Does SN74LVC1G240 support hot-swap or live-insertion applications?
Yes. SN74LVC1G240 includes Ioff circuitry that disables all outputs when VCC = 0V, limiting leakage current to ±10μA. This prevents back-driving and current flow between powered and unpowered circuit sections - a requirement for hot-swap compliance per JESD78 Class II latch-up immunity (>100mA) and safe insertion into live backplanes or modular systems.
What is the maximum capacitive load SN74LVC1G240 can drive while maintaining specified timing?
SN74LVC1G240 maintains full AC specifications (including 3.7ns max tpd) with CL = 15pF. It can reliably drive up to 50pF while remaining within datasheet limits, though propagation delay increases - e.g., tpd rises to 4.5ns at 3.3V/50pF. For loads >50pF, TI recommends adding a series damping resistor near the output to suppress ringing and maintain signal integrity.
Is SN74LVC1G240 pin-compatible with other 5-pin logic devices in DSBGA packaging?
No. While SN74LVC1G240 YZP uses a standardized 5-ball DSBGA footprint, ball assignment (OE-A-GND-Y-VCC) is function-specific and differs from non-inverting buffers (e.g., SN74LVC1G125), inverters (SN74LVC1G04), or non-inverting drivers. Direct replacement requires matching both pinout and logic function - always verify against the exact device's Pin Configuration table (Figure 4-2) before PCB reuse.
